Tallahassee Memorial Healthcare (TMH) is a private, nonprofit community-based healthcare system serving a 22-county region in North Florida and South Georgia. As a career destination, TMH employs over 6,000 colleagues and is the region's healthcare leader, offering advanced care with a 772-bed acute care hospital. It boasts the region's only Level II Trauma Center, Primary Stroke Center, Level III Neonatal Intensive Care Unit, and Pediatric Intensive Care Unit, along with the most advanced cancer, heart and vascular, orthopedic, and surgery programs in the Panhandle. The system also includes a psychiatric hospital, multiple specialty care centers, six residency programs, and over 50 affiliated physician practices. This entry-level position offers a pathway to professional career progression within the sonography/ultrasound discipline. The role involves performing routine assignments using established procedures and applying conceptual knowledge of theories, practices, and procedures. The sonographer will develop competence through structured work assignments under the guidance of others. Key responsibilities include operating diagnostic imaging equipment on patients to examine tissue and body structures, performing various diagnostic sonographic examinations on adult and/or pediatric patients using ultrasonic equipment in different modes and techniques to gather data for diagnosis and treatment, and performing/assisting with cardiovascular diagnostic procedures such as adult echocardiograms, stress echoes, non-surgical transesophageal echocardiograms (TEE), carotid ultrasounds, and pulse volume recordings (PVR). Additional duties include scheduling and coordinating tests, preparing and maintaining operational logs, recording and documenting test results, updating patient records for referring physicians, and ensuring proper patient care and safety during procedures.

Requirements

  • High school diploma (or equivalent)
  • Graduation from an accredited sonography program
  • None (required experience)
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) certification
  • One (1) of the following credentials: Registered Diagnostic Cardiac Sonographer (RDCS), Adult Echocardiography (AE); RDCS, Pediatric Echocardiography (PE); RDCS, Fetal Echocardiography (FE); Registered Vascular Technologist (RVT); Registered Cardiac Sonographer (RCS); Registered Congenital Cardiac Sonographer (RCCS); or Registered Vascular Specialist (RVS). NOTE: Credentials must be applicable to the work performed in the specific department assigned.
